Prague Dragon Boat Autumn
Indohusbands + wives + friends in Chinese and Indonesian dragon boat race with a surprising success!
- info: Indonesia presented two dragonboats - Pantun and Gurindam from the Riau province for Prague 2009 Dragonboat festival at Cisarska Louka (12-13 September 2009). In response, the committee invited Indonesians to take part in the Dragonboat festival and be exempt from 7,500 kc team fee. Eighteen paddlers plus a drummer and a steersman went for 250 meter race on Corporate Cup. The surprise part is that majority of the team are not Indonesians but a collection of spouses and friends from Indonesian community. The best part is that team who are not regular paddlers and had only met and practised once, went ahead to the final with other 5 teams! Celebrate that! Cannot wait for the next year festival.
